Add memory format support to `randn_like` operator (#27890)

Summary:
Pull Request resolved: https://github.com/pytorch/pytorch/pull/27890

Adds memory_format keyword argument (positional for cpp).

'Preserve' behavior now follows next rules:
1) If tensor is non-overlapping and dense - output tensor will have the same strides as input tensor.
2) If not (1) and tensor is stored in the channels last format, output tensor going to have channels last format.
3) Output tensor is going to be contiguous in all other cases.

 ---
Dense tensor is the tensor that store values in a contiguous block of memory.
Non-overlapping tensor is the tensor in which elements occupy individual non-repetitive memory.

diff --git a/aten/src/ATen/native/TensorFactories.cpp b/aten/src/ATen/native/TensorFactories.cpp
index 9191b04..2903d93 100644
--- a/aten/src/ATen/native/TensorFactories.cpp
+++ b/aten/src/ATen/native/TensorFactories.cpp
@@ -566,12 +566,18 @@
   return result.normal_(mean, std, generator);
 }
 
-Tensor randn_like(const Tensor& self) {
-  return native::randn_like(self, self.options());
+Tensor randn_like(
+    const Tensor& self,
+    c10::optional<c10::MemoryFormat> optional_memory_format) {
+  return native::randn_like(self, self.options(), optional_memory_format);
 }
 
-Tensor randn_like(const Tensor& self, const TensorOptions& options) {
-  return native::randn(self.sizes(), nullptr, options);
+Tensor randn_like(
+    const Tensor& self,
+    const TensorOptions& options,
+    c10::optional<c10::MemoryFormat> optional_memory_format) {
+  auto result = at::empty_like(self, options, optional_memory_format);
+  return result.normal_(0, 1, nullptr);
 }
